Subject2.6.0-test7: unstable on laptop
Since 2.6.0-test6 Linux just hangs from time to time. Hardware in
question is a omnibook (laptop (hp omnibook 6100, P3m, i830m chipset).
Frequency is about twice a day.

The system hangs regardless of the current workload, sysrg is still
working, but the computer is not ping-able. This problem could be
verified with 2.6.0-test7-bk[3-5], disabling power managment in
2.6.0-test7-bk5 didn't kills it of.

There are no log messages concerning the bug.

I'm now trying 2.6.0-test7-bk6 without power-management.

Any suggestions?
